Output 6e66c20ce6364df1599037a0cccaa3bfc44bb4b2b53a0743e85bacaaa4ccb674:3

value
78309
script pubkey
OP_0 OP_PUSHBYTES_20 d3e8052308c6b3c3b45561a86414f80ab67f758c
address
bc1q605q2gcgc6eu8dz4vx5xg98cp2m87avvxdsdtm
transaction
6e66c20ce6364df1599037a0cccaa3bfc44bb4b2b53a0743e85bacaaa4ccb674
spent
true